The Ministry of Education announced that it has launched an extensive investigation into an incident at an international school involving the collection of parents' national ID card photos under the guise of updating data. Subsequently, large educational loans were registered in their names without their knowledge or signatures. A parent of a student reported that the school administration requested the data a year ago. When some families discovered loans amounting to up to 700,000 Egyptian pounds in their names, an investigation was conducted, revealing that the loans were documented without their approval. Some installments have been paid, while investigations are still ongoing with the prosecutor's office and financial oversight authorities.
